Who uses POPFile for spam filtering and Mailsmith as a mail client can quickly jump from an email to the reclassification page in POPFile with the linked AppleScript. The script simply extracts the X-POPFile-Link header from the email and navigates to the specified URL. Without this script, you always have to first show the headers, find the link, click on it, and then hide the headers again. Annoying. But solvable with AppleScript. Here's the original article.
